Gianluca Tamaro is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Surgery and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Gianluca Tamaro has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 258 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, 8 papers in Surgery and 8 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Gianluca Tamaro's work include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(4 papers),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(4 papers) and Diabetes Management and Research (3 papers). Gianluca Tamaro is often cited by papers focused on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(4 papers),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(4 papers) and Diabetes Management and Research (3 papers). Gianluca Tamaro coll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Slovenia and Netherlands. Gianluca Tamaro's co-authors include Giovanni Ciana, Luca Ronfani, Bruno Bembi, Egidio Barbi, Augusto B. Federici, P.M. Mannucci, Dario C. Altieri, Giorgio Candotti, Francesco Tedesco and Gianluca Tornese and has published in prestigious journals such as Diabetes Care, The Journal of Pediatrics and Human Reproduction.
